How do counselors and therapists differ from one another?

Therapists provide long-term care, whereas counselors typically provide short-term care. Counselors may be more future-focused, whereas therapists may be more focused on the past. Many therapists work continuously, while counselors frequently have a predetermined number of sessions. Psychological disorders are more frequently treated by therapists. What do counselors do on the most fundamental level?

Professional counselors work to strengthen self-esteem, promote behavior change, and maintain optimal mental health. They also assist clients in identifying goals and potential solutions to issues that cause emotional distress. Counselors: What do they do?

Counselors work with clients going through a variety of emotional and psychological challenges to help them make lasting change and/or improve their wellbeing. The ability of clients to manage their lives may be impacted by problems like depression, anxiety, stress, loss, and relationship difficulties.
